    Spa pump died and was under warranty. Service company replaced it but with a cheaper version.

    It was explained to me by a spa parts dealer that the Hp rating is kind of gimmicky. They told me that that you always go by the Amp draw to determine what pump you need. It looks like they replaced your pump with a very close match, so I wouldn't worry about it.

    Heater died, should I replace the whole thing or just the heating element?

    If you think you can do it yourself, I would. It's less than $50 in parts if you don't need the tube. I would order the element, a new set of wires and maybe two new seals. Spa Heater Elements
